About the role
As a (Contract) Lifecycle Marketing Coordinator, you will be focused on supporting and elevating CRM/Lifecycle marketing campaigns that market all lines of business for us: Manga, Theatrical, and Games. This is a 3 month contract.
- You will develop and collaborate on global lifecycle marketing campaigns to improve user engagement, upsells, retention, and re-engagement.
- You will identify Lifecycle areas of opportunity and implement programs to increase conversions and retention optimization.
- You will work directly with other departments and external agencies to deliver global Marketing campaigns
- You will manage end-to-end processes for integrated campaigns across email, push notifications, in-app messages, and in-product - including identifying campaign opportunities, developing strategy and messaging, overseeing asset creation.
In the role of (Contract) Lifecycle Marketing Coordinator, you will report to the Senior Manager, Lifecycle Marketing Manager .

About You
We get excited about candidates, like you, because...
- 2+ years of CRM/Lifecycle Marketing experience
- Experience in retention marketing, or in a digital marketing/analytics function that uses email, push notifications, and in-app messages, or other owned channels.
- Experience working with multiple Marketing departments to manage multiple marketing campaigns across different countries and time zones.
- Experience working with complex localized marketing projects, coordinating logistics with many different international partners
- Experience using marketing automation tools or email marketing platforms like Braze EMS to manage the build of personalized automated customer journeys
- Experience with project management tools like Airtable to manage marketing schedules across several channels.
- Bachelor's Degree in Marketing, Business, or similar.

Crunchyroll, LLC is an independently operated joint venture between US-based Sony Pictures Entertainment, and Japan's Aniplex, a subsidiary of Sony Music Entertainment (Japan) Inc., both subsidiaries of Tokyo-based Sony Group Corporation.
